← TechnologyWhich outcome occurs when receiver amplifier saturation increases markedly in a wireless telecommunications base station?
A)Desired signal distortion increases rapidly✓
B)Frequency-shift keying bit errors decrease
C)Overall signal gain remains unchanged
D)Adjacent cell interference reduces noticeably
💡 Explanation
Increased saturation leads to signal distortion because of amplifier non-linearity causing harmonic generation; therefore, the desired signal is badly affected, rather than improved performance cases or reduced external interference because saturation is an internal amplifier problem.
